Responsibilities and Daily Duties
Daily duties involve cleaning office desks, floors, and common areas. Maintaining hygiene in restrooms and replenishing consumables is also expected.
Warehouse floors must be swept, mopped, and kept tidy, with particular attention to workspaces and frequently touched surfaces like counters and windows.
The cleaner will keep the reception area neat, ensuring floors, windows, and even displayed products remain spotless. Safety is prioritised by immediately reporting maintenance issues or hazards to the supervisor.
Occasionally, assistance is given with ad hoc tasks as assigned by your supervisor, adding some variety to the role. Dusting and gentle cleaning of computers used by technicians is part of the job.
